What is the difference between spray painting and brush painting walls in Holme-upon-Spalding-Moor?
Spray painting with HVLP equipment deposits paint as an atomised mist that settles as a perfectly smooth, uniform film with no brush marks, no roller stipple and no lap lines. Brush and roller painting always leaves evidence of the application tool in the finish. The sprayed result looks genuinely flat, not just uniform in colour, and is harder and more durable than brush-applied paint of the same type.

What preparation is needed before interior spray painting in Holme-upon-Spalding-Moor?
We carry out all surface preparation ourselves. This includes filling holes and cracks, sanding to create mechanical adhesion, cleaning and degreasing surfaces, and applying the appropriate primer before topcoats. The quality of preparation is the foundation of a long-lasting finish. We never rush this stage.

What finishes and sheens are available for interior spray painting in Holme-upon-Spalding-Moor?
We offer matt, eggshell and satin finishes for interior spray painting in Holme-upon-Spalding-Moor. Matt is most suitable for walls and ceilings. Eggshell is the most popular choice for woodwork because it is durable, washable and has a clean, refined appearance without being overly glossy. Satin is available where a higher sheen is preferred.
